The 2017 Fete on Saturday 1st July raised almost £4,500.
Fete day, July 1st, dawned gray and drizzling but, as so often in previous years, by 2 pm we were enjoying blue skies and warm summer sunshine!

The fete was opened by Charlie the Scarecrow’s Uncle Silas. It may be that Charlie was busy preparing for the Scarecrow Festival in September.
